Adapted Physical Activity and Tango-Based Therapy for Parkinson's Disease: A Pilot Study

The purpose of this clinical research is to evaluate the effectiveness of a structured Tango-based (Riabilitango®) therapy compared to a conventional Motor Reconditioning program and a Control group in individuals diagnosed with Parkinson's Disease. The study assesses changes in motor performance, balance, gait kinematics, functional strenght, and health-related quality of life over a 3-month intervention period and a 3-month post-intervention follow-up.

About this study

Parkinson's disease is characterized by motor deficits affecting gait, postural control, and dynamic balance. This study compares two exercise-based rehabilitation approaches against a control group:

Riabilitango® (Tango Therapy): Supervised group sessions (2 times/week, 60 minutes/session for 3 months) focusing on balance, trunk mobility, rhythm-synchronised walking, and adapted Argentine tango figures.

Motor Reconditioning: Supervised small-group sessions (2 times/week, 60 minutes/session for 3 months) including cycling warm-up, progressive treadmill walking (60-70% max heart rate), upper/lower-limb functional training, and stretching exercises.

Control Group: Follows usual care without participating in the structured rehabilitation interventions during the study period.

Comprehensive clinical, functional, and biomechanical evaluations are conducted at baseline, monthly during the 3-month intervention period, and at a 3-month post-intervention follow-up (6 months total observation period).

Inclusion criteria

  • Confirmed clinical diagnosis of idiopathic Parkinson's Disease.
  • Mild to moderate disease severity (Hoehn and Yahr stage I-III).
  • Ability to walk independently (with or without assistive devices).
  • Stable antiparkinsonian pharmacological treatment for at least 4 weeks prior to enrollment.
  • Ability to understand study procedures and willingness to sign the Informed Consent document.

Exclusion criteria

  • Severe cognitive impairment or dementia preventing comprehension of instructions or active participation.
  • Severe cardiovascular, respiratory, orthopedic, or other neurological conditions that impair safe exercise participation or gait evaluation.
  • Surgical interventions that directly affect mobility or dynamic balance (e.g., Deep Brain Stimulation or recent major orthopedic surgery).
  • Concurrent participation in other physical rehabilitation programs or clinical trials during the study period.

Primary outcomes

  1. Change in Unified Parkinson's Disease Rating Scale (UPDRS) Part III Motor Examination Score

    Time frame: Baseline, Month 1, Month 2, Month 3, and 3-month post-intervention follow-up (Month 6)

    The UPDRS Part III evaluates motor function in individuals with Parkinson's disease, including speech, facial expression, tremor, rigidity, finger taps, hand movements, gait, posture, and bradykinesia. Scores range from 0 to 56, with higher scores indicating greater motor impairment.

Secondary outcomes

  1. Timed Up and Go (TUG) Test Time

    Time frame: Baseline, Month 1, Month 2, Month 3, and 3-month post-intervention follow-up (Month 6)

    Time in seconds taken by the participant to stand up from a chair, walk 3 meters, turn around, walk back, and sit down. Shorter completion times indicate better functional mobility.

  2. Six-Minute Walk Test (6MWT) Distance

    Time frame: Baseline, Month 1, Month 2, Month 3, and 3-month post-intervention follow-up (Month 6)

    Total distance walked in meters during 6 minutes. Higher values indicate better functional walking endurance.

  3. Handgrip Strength

    Time frame: Baseline, Month 1, Month 2, Month 3, and 3-month post-intervention follow-up (Month 6)

    Maximum isometric handgrip force measured using a digital dynamometer. Higher values indicate greater upper-limb muscle strength.
